Federal Election 2015: West Vancouver-Sunshine Coast-Sea to Sky Country riding results

Real time live results available on Monday, October 19 2015 after polls close. Overall results will be available here.

Summary: A sprawling riding with several high-profile candidates, West Vancouver-Sunshine Coast-Sea to Sky Country is considered a riding to watch in this year’s election.

Boundaries: An large, diverse riding on B.C.’s west coast, West Vancouver-Sunshine Coast-Sea to Sky Country includes all of West Vancouver, Bowen Island, the Sunshine Coast from Gibsons to Nelson Island, and all the towns along the Sea-to-Sky Highway until Joffre Lakes Provincial Park.

Last Election: John Weston took this riding over NDP candidate Terry Platt by 22.1 per cent to win his second term.

History: Blair Wilson won this seat for the Liberal Party in 2006, but otherwise the region has supported right-wing candidates since 1974.

Demographics: The average income is $57,554, the second highest in the province.

Candidates

Conservative: John Weston, MP since 2008

NDP: Larry Koopman, Squamish small businessman

Liberal: Pamela Goldsmith-Jones, two-term West Vancouver mayor

Green: Ken Melamed, former Whistler mayor

Marxist-Leninist: Carol-Lee Chapman

Marijuana: Robin Kehler
